
Lionel Richie is putting his weight behind a 27-minute documentary short that has nothing to do with music. On Oct. 1, the singer opened up his Beverly Hills house for an intimate event with 20 guests to screen The Tuskegee Airmen: Sacrifice and Triumph, about the first African-American fighter pilots.
